John Hair & Son, 16 Church Street, Melbourne, Derbyshire.
Founded 1851.
Dallman and Hair operated briefly together as brewers at this address in 1855.
Francis Dallman then moved to Derby Road.
Acquired by Offiler's Brewery Ltd. 1954 with one tied house.
Brewery converted into a house and is still standing.
